




So I have been keeping some personal info quiet for a bit. Grandma always seemed invincible to me. She was born in Sioux City, Iowa, lived through the depression, raised a family and enjoyed five great-grandchildren. From the time I was a child she was my protector. She cared for me, she loved me and she made sure my mom wasn't too hard on me. She lived two block away from my family and she was such an integral part of my life. In 19 days she would have been 90, but God had different plans for her. After a long battle with congestive heart failure and leukemia, a stroke silenced her beautiful voice and stole her soft smile about a week ago.
Unfortunately for us, grandma left this world last night but she beat her pain, she is still invincible to me. She was in a hospice facility in Covina for the last three days. The entire family could be with her until the end. Marlene and I were with her on Friday and after our wedding on Saturday we spent more time with her. Ray and Zoe were both able to say goodbye. I was fortunate to be by her side when she passed. My family will be celebrating her life over the next few days.
I will certainly miss her, but Grandma will always be the beautiful soul looking over us. Hug your loved ones my friends.....
